mirror of
https://github.com/openjdk/jdk.git
synced 2025-09-18 18:14:38 +02:00
8263890: Broken links to Unicode.org
Reviewed-by: redestad, joehw, iris
This commit is contained in:
parent
4d9517d233
commit
96e5c3f1e0
8 changed files with 37 additions and 33 deletions
|
@ -1,5 +1,5 @@
|
|||
/*
|
||||
* Copyright (c) 2000, 2020, Oracle and/or its affiliates. All rights reserved.
|
||||
* Copyright (c) 2000, 2021, Oracle and/or its affiliates. All rights reserved.
|
||||
* D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
|
||||
*
|
||||
* This code is free software; you can redistribute it and/or modify it
|
||||
|
@ -174,14 +174,14 @@ import java.util.TreeMap;
|
|||
* href="http://www.ietf.org/rfc/rfc2279.txt"><i>RFC 2279</i></a>; the
|
||||
* transformation format upon which it is based is specified in
|
||||
* Amendment 2 of ISO 10646-1 and is also described in the <a
|
||||
* href="http://www.unicode.org/unicode/standard/standard.html"><i>Unicode
|
||||
* href="http://www.unicode.org/standard/standard.html"><i>Unicode
|
||||
* Standard</i></a>.
|
||||
*
|
||||
* <p> The {@code UTF-16} charsets are specified by <a
|
||||
* href="http://www.ietf.org/rfc/rfc2781.txt"><i>RFC 2781</i></a>; the
|
||||
* transformation formats upon which they are based are specified in
|
||||
* Amendment 1 of ISO 10646-1 and are also described in the <a
|
||||
* href="http://www.unicode.org/unicode/standard/standard.html"><i>Unicode
|
||||
* href="http://www.unicode.org/standard/standard.html"><i>Unicode
|
||||
* Standard</i></a>.
|
||||
*
|
||||
* <p> The {@code UTF-16} charsets use sixteen-bit quantities and are
|
||||
|
|
|
@ -1,5 +1,5 @@
|
|||
/*
|
||||
* Copyright (c) 1997, 2019, Oracle and/or its affiliates. All rights reserved.
|
||||
* Copyright (c) 1997, 2021, Oracle and/or its affiliates. All rights reserved.
|
||||
* D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
|
||||
*
|
||||
* This code is free software; you can redistribute it and/or modify it
|
||||
|
@ -189,8 +189,8 @@ public abstract class Collator
|
|||
* <p>
|
||||
* CANONICAL_DECOMPOSITION corresponds to Normalization Form D as
|
||||
* described in
|
||||
* <a href="http://www.unicode.org/unicode/reports/tr15/tr15-23.html">Unicode
|
||||
* Technical Report #15</a>.
|
||||
* <a href="http://www.unicode.org/reports/tr15/">Unicode
|
||||
* Standard Annex #15: Unicode Normalization Forms</a>.
|
||||
* @see java.text.Collator#getDecomposition
|
||||
* @see java.text.Collator#setDecomposition
|
||||
*/
|
||||
|
@ -208,8 +208,8 @@ public abstract class Collator
|
|||
* <p>
|
||||
* FULL_DECOMPOSITION corresponds to Normalization Form KD as
|
||||
* described in
|
||||
* <a href="http://www.unicode.org/unicode/reports/tr15/tr15-23.html">Unicode
|
||||
* Technical Report #15</a>.
|
||||
* <a href="http://www.unicode.org/reports/tr15/">Unicode
|
||||
* Standard Annex #15: Unicode Normalization Forms</a>.
|
||||
* @see java.text.Collator#getDecomposition
|
||||
* @see java.text.Collator#setDecomposition
|
||||
*/
|
||||
|
|
|
@ -1,5 +1,5 @@
|
|||
/*
|
||||
* Copyright (c) 1999, 2020, Oracle and/or its affiliates. All rights reserved.
|
||||
* Copyright (c) 1999, 2021, Oracle and/or its affiliates. All rights reserved.
|
||||
* D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
|
||||
*
|
||||
* This code is free software; you can redistribute it and/or modify it
|
||||
|
@ -539,7 +539,7 @@ import jdk.internal.util.ArraysSupport;
|
|||
*
|
||||
* <p> This class is in conformance with Level 1 of <a
|
||||
* href="http://www.unicode.org/reports/tr18/"><i>Unicode Technical
|
||||
* Standard #18: Unicode Regular Expression</i></a>, plus RL2.1
|
||||
* Standard #18: Unicode Regular Expressions</i></a>, plus RL2.1
|
||||
* Canonical Equivalents and RL2.2 Extended Grapheme Clusters.
|
||||
* <p>
|
||||
* <b>Unicode escape sequences</b> such as <code>\u2014</code> in Java source code
|
||||
|
@ -602,7 +602,7 @@ import jdk.internal.util.ArraysSupport;
|
|||
* {@code gc}) as in {@code general_category=Lu} or {@code gc=Lu}.
|
||||
* <p>
|
||||
* The supported categories are those of
|
||||
* <a href="http://www.unicode.org/unicode/standard/standard.html">
|
||||
* <a href="http://www.unicode.org/standard/standard.html">
|
||||
* <i>The Unicode Standard</i></a> in the version specified by the
|
||||
* {@link java.lang.Character Character} class. The category names are those
|
||||
* defined in the Standard, both normative and informative.
|
||||
|
@ -630,8 +630,8 @@ import jdk.internal.util.ArraysSupport;
|
|||
* <p>
|
||||
* The following <b>Predefined Character classes</b> and <b>POSIX character classes</b>
|
||||
* are in conformance with the recommendation of <i>Annex C: Compatibility Properties</i>
|
||||
* of <a href="http://www.unicode.org/reports/tr18/"><i>Unicode Regular Expression
|
||||
* </i></a>, when {@link #UNICODE_CHARACTER_CLASS} flag is specified.
|
||||
* of <a href="http://www.unicode.org/reports/tr18/"><i>Unicode Technical Standard #18:
|
||||
* Unicode Regular Expressions</i></a>, when {@link #UNICODE_CHARACTER_CLASS} flag is specified.
|
||||
*
|
||||
* <table class="striped">
|
||||
* <caption style="display:none">predefined and posix character classes in Unicode mode</caption>
|
||||
|
@ -906,7 +906,7 @@ public final class Pattern
|
|||
* <i>Predefined character classes</i> and <i>POSIX character classes</i>
|
||||
* are in conformance with
|
||||
* <a href="http://www.unicode.org/reports/tr18/"><i>Unicode Technical
|
||||
* Standard #18: Unicode Regular Expression</i></a>
|
||||
* Standard #18: Unicode Regular Expressions</i></a>
|
||||
* <i>Annex C: Compatibility Properties</i>.
|
||||
* <p>
|
||||
* The UNICODE_CHARACTER_CLASS mode can also be enabled via the embedded
|
||||
|
|
|
@ -1,5 +1,5 @@
|
|||
/*
|
||||
* Copyright (c) 2009, 2020, Oracle and/or its affiliates. All rights reserved.
|
||||
* Copyright (c) 2009, 2021, Oracle and/or its affiliates. All rights reserved.
|
||||
* D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
|
||||
*
|
||||
* This code is free software; you can redistribute it and/or modify it
|
||||
|
@ -62,8 +62,9 @@ import jdk.internal.icu.impl.UBiDiProps;
|
|||
* <h2>Bidi algorithm for ICU</h2>
|
||||
*
|
||||
* This is an implementation of the Unicode Bidirectional Algorithm. The
|
||||
* algorithm is defined in the <a
|
||||
* href="http://www.unicode.org/unicode/reports/tr9/">Unicode Standard Annex #9</a>.
|
||||
* algorithm is defined in the
|
||||
* <a href="http://www.unicode.org/reports/tr9/">Unicode Standard Annex #9:
|
||||
* Unicode Bidirectional Algorithm</a>.
|
||||
* <p>
|
||||
*
|
||||
* Note: Libraries that perform a bidirectional algorithm and reorder strings
|
||||
|
@ -983,8 +984,9 @@ public class BidiBase {
|
|||
|
||||
/**
|
||||
* Enumerated property Bidi_Paired_Bracket_Type (new in Unicode 6.3).
|
||||
* Used in UAX #9: Unicode Bidirectional Algorithm
|
||||
* (http://www.unicode.org/reports/tr9/)
|
||||
* Used in
|
||||
* <a href="http://www.unicode.org/reports/tr9/">Unicode Standard Annex #9:
|
||||
* Unicode Bidirectional Algorithm</a>.
|
||||
* Returns UCharacter.BidiPairedBracketType values.
|
||||
* @stable ICU 52
|
||||
*/
|
||||
|
@ -3363,8 +3365,8 @@ public class BidiBase {
|
|||
|
||||
/**
|
||||
* Perform the Unicode Bidi algorithm. It is defined in the
|
||||
* <a href="http://www.unicode.org/unicode/reports/tr9/">Unicode Standard Annex #9</a>,
|
||||
* version 13,
|
||||
* <a href="http://www.unicode.org/reports/tr9/">Unicode Standard Annex #9:
|
||||
* Unicode Bidirectional Algorithm</a>, version 13,
|
||||
* also described in The Unicode Standard, Version 4.0 .<p>
|
||||
*
|
||||
* This method takes a piece of plain text containing one or more paragraphs,
|
||||
|
@ -3448,8 +3450,8 @@ public class BidiBase {
|
|||
|
||||
/**
|
||||
* Perform the Unicode Bidi algorithm. It is defined in the
|
||||
* <a href="http://www.unicode.org/unicode/reports/tr9/">Unicode Standard Annex #9</a>,
|
||||
* version 13,
|
||||
* <a href="http://www.unicode.org/reports/tr9/">Unicode Standard Annex #9:
|
||||
* Unicode Bidirectional Algorithm</a>, version 13,
|
||||
* also described in The Unicode Standard, Version 4.0 .<p>
|
||||
*
|
||||
* This method takes a piece of plain text containing one or more paragraphs,
|
||||
|
@ -3784,8 +3786,8 @@ public class BidiBase {
|
|||
|
||||
/**
|
||||
* Perform the Unicode Bidi algorithm on a given paragraph, as defined in the
|
||||
* <a href="http://www.unicode.org/unicode/reports/tr9/">Unicode Standard Annex #9</a>,
|
||||
* version 13,
|
||||
* <a href="http://www.unicode.org/reports/tr9/">Unicode Standard Annex #9:
|
||||
* Unicode Bidirectional Algorithm</a>, version 13,
|
||||
* also described in The Unicode Standard, Version 4.0 .<p>
|
||||
*
|
||||
* This method takes a paragraph of text and computes the
|
||||
|
|
|
@ -1,5 +1,5 @@
|
|||
/*
|
||||
* Copyright (c) 2009, 2020, Oracle and/or its affiliates. All rights reserved.
|
||||
* Copyright (c) 2009, 2021, Oracle and/or its affiliates. All rights reserved.
|
||||
* D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
|
||||
*
|
||||
* This code is free software; you can redistribute it and/or modify it
|
||||
|
@ -47,7 +47,8 @@ final class BidiLine {
|
|||
* text in a single paragraph or in a line of a single paragraph
|
||||
* which has already been processed according to
|
||||
* the Unicode 3.0 Bidi algorithm as defined in
|
||||
* http://www.unicode.org/unicode/reports/tr9/ , version 13,
|
||||
* <a href="http://www.unicode.org/reports/tr9/">Unicode Standard Annex #9:
|
||||
* Unicode Bidirectional Algorithm</a>, version 13,
|
||||
* also described in The Unicode Standard, Version 4.0.1 .
|
||||
*
|
||||
* This means that there is a Bidi object with a levels
|
||||
|
|
|
@ -1,5 +1,5 @@
|
|||
/*
|
||||
* Copyright (c) 2015, 2020, Oracle and/or its affiliates. All rights reserved.
|
||||
* Copyright (c) 2015, 2021, Oracle and/or its affiliates. All rights reserved.
|
||||
* D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
|
||||
*
|
||||
* This code is free software; you can redistribute it and/or modify it
|
||||
|
@ -43,7 +43,8 @@ import jdk.internal.icu.impl.Norm2AllModes;
|
|||
* The primary functions are to produce a normalized string and to detect whether
|
||||
* a string is already normalized.
|
||||
* The most commonly used normalization forms are those defined in
|
||||
* http://www.unicode.org/unicode/reports/tr15/
|
||||
* <a href="http://www.unicode.org/reports/tr15/">Unicode Standard Annex #15:
|
||||
* Unicode Normalization Forms</a>.
|
||||
* However, this API supports additional normalization forms for specialized purposes.
|
||||
* For example, NFKC_Casefold is provided via getInstance("nfkc_cf", COMPOSE)
|
||||
* and can be used in implementations of UTS #46.
|
||||
|
|
|
@ -1,5 +1,5 @@
|
|||
/*
|
||||
* Copyright (c) 2005, 2020, Oracle and/or its affiliates. All rights reserved.
|
||||
* Copyright (c) 2005, 2021, Oracle and/or its affiliates. All rights reserved.
|
||||
* D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
|
||||
*
|
||||
* This code is free software; you can redistribute it and/or modify it
|
||||
|
@ -44,7 +44,7 @@ import java.text.Normalizer;
|
|||
* <code>normalize</code> transforms Unicode text into an equivalent composed or
|
||||
* decomposed form, allowing for easier sorting and searching of text.
|
||||
* <code>normalize</code> supports the standard normalization forms described in
|
||||
* <a href="http://www.unicode.org/unicode/reports/tr15/" target="unicode">
|
||||
* <a href="http://www.unicode.org/reports/tr15/" target="unicode">
|
||||
* Unicode Standard Annex #15 — Unicode Normalization Forms</a>.
|
||||
*
|
||||
* Characters with accents or other adornments can be encoded in
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ue